c语言中的局部变量和全局变量
标签: c语言
标签: c语言
会报错的,全局变量是具有外部链接属性的,而static修饰的全局变量的时候就把这个外部链接属性变成了内部链接属性。这就导致其他源文件不能使用该全局变量了。声明在函数内部的变量叫局部变量,局部变量的作用域是...
可以声明全局变量以在函数之间共享数据。全局变量不在任何函数之内,全局变量可在任何地方访问。示例代码#include int count = 0; // 第3行,声明一个全局变量// 声明函数void test1(void);void test2(void);int ...
在C++中,如果你希望在多个源文件中共享同一个全局变量,你需要在其中一个源文件中进行定义,而其他源文件则需要对该全局变量进行声明。这样,其他源文件就可以通过包含 common.h 头文件来访问这个全局变量了。要在 ...
信的名字是某种类型的 别名,改善了程序的可读性最后一个单词就是新名字int mouth;int day;int year;}Data;Lenght i=8;return 0;#开头的是编译预处理指令它们不是C语言的成分,但是C语言程序离不开它们#define用来...
C++中的全局变量可能会带来一些潜在的...为了解决这些问题,我们可以使用一些增强检测方法,例如将全局变量定义在命名空间中,使用常量代替不变的全局变量,使用局部变量代替全局变量,使用封装机制和使用单例模式。
全局变量(Global Variable)和局部变量(Local Variable)是两种不同作用域的变量。
本文主要介绍Jmeter中,如何设置全局变量,以及如何引用全局变量。
我们也知道在Python中有一个global关键字用来声明一个全局变量。那这玩意儿到底什么用。来看看global keykey="first()的key"print("进入first函数,给key赋新值,此时print(key)得到***"+key+"***\n")print("进入...
文件中定义了同名的全局变量,这会导致编译时的符号冲突,因为编译器会将这些变量视为同一个变量。在C语言中,全局变量(也称为外部变量)是在函数外部定义的变量,它们的作用域从定义的位置开始,一直到文件结束...
该变量在全局数据区分配内存;静态局部变量在程序执行到该对象的声明处时被首次初始化,即以后的函数调用不再进行初始化;静态局部变量一般在声明处初始化,如果没有显式初始化,会被程序自动初始化为 0;它始终驻留...
全局变量的声明、定义及用法 文章目录全局变量的声明、定义及用法1. 编译单元(模块)2. 声明和定义3. extern 作用4. 全局变量(extern)4.1 如果直接将声明和定义都放在头文件中会如何?5. 静态全局变量(static)6. 全局...
2023-04-06-项目笔记-第八十五...写代码注意代码风格 4.3.1变量的使用 4.4变量的作用域与生命周期 4.4.1局部变量的作用域 4.4.2全局变量的作用域 4.4.2.1全局变量的作用域_1 4.4.2.83全局变量的作用域_83 - 2024-03-27
C++全局变量
2023-04-06-项目笔记-第八十五...写代码注意代码风格 4.3.1变量的使用 4.4变量的作用域与生命周期 4.4.1局部变量的作用域 4.4.2全局变量的作用域 4.4.2.1全局变量的作用域_1 4.4.2.83全局变量的作用域_83 - 2024-03-27
构造函数:
2023-04-06-项目笔记-第八十四...写代码注意代码风格 4.3.1变量的使用 4.4变量的作用域与生命周期 4.4.1局部变量的作用域 4.4.2全局变量的作用域 4.4.2.1全局变量的作用域_1 4.4.2.82全局变量的作用域_82 - 2024-03-26
2023-04-06-项目笔记-第八十四...写代码注意代码风格 4.3.1变量的使用 4.4变量的作用域与生命周期 4.4.1局部变量的作用域 4.4.2全局变量的作用域 4.4.2.1全局变量的作用域_1 4.4.2.82全局变量的作用域_82 - 2024-03-26
LabVIEW全局变量是一种在整个LabVIEW程序中可以共享和访问的变量。全局变量可以在程序的任何地方进行读取和写入操作,以便在不同的VI(Virtual Instrument,虚拟仪器)之间共享数据。
如何在函数中创建或使用全局变量?如何使用在其他函数中的一个函数中定义的全局变量?
c、c++基本知识点:作用域、全局变量(extern)、局部变量等
在Vue项目中我们需要使用许多的变量来维护数据的流向和状态,这些变量可以是本地变量、组件变量、父子组件变量等,但这些变量都是有...在一些场景中,可能需要在多个组件中共享某个变量,此时全局变量就派上了用场。
Python的全局变量、局部变量、类变量、实例变量介绍
标签: java
文章目录一、变量二、类变量(静态变量)三、实例变量(成员变量)四、局部变量五、实例变量与局部变量的区别六、全局变量 小编一直分不清成员变量和局部变量,认为它们是一个东西,现在跟着小编来看一看,到底一样还是...
在C#程序中,为了在不同的作用域(cs文件或From界面)之间传递数据,可以使用public static对象来定义全局变量,程序调用时使用(类.变量)方式;C#中不再有全局变量、函数或者常量。
这里写目录标题局部变量全局变量静态局部变量静态全局变量 局部变量 局部变量具有局部作用域。他是自动对象,他在程序运行期间不是一直存在,而是只在函数执行期间存在,函数的一次调用结束后,变量就被撤销,其所...
C语言的全局变量分为两类: 一、文件全局变量 二、工程全局变量 把这两类全局变量搞清楚了,你也可以写出高质量的C程序。